WIC is excited to announce the launch of our 7th Cloud Accelerator Cohort, beginning virtually on May 26th, 2022. Our unique accelerator program enables female tech founders to leverage the power of partnering with hyperscalers like Microsoft, Google, and IBM to become enterprise and Cosell ready. 

Women in Cloud has successfully graduated 70+ women-led companies over 6 previous cohorts with a global expansion including 9 countries around the world: United States, Canada, the United Kingdom, France, Germany, India, Kenya, South Africa and the United Arab Emirates.

The WIC entrepreneur community asked and We ANSWERED! We’ve adjusted the program to be even better than before.

Now A 3-month immersive program with even MORE benefits, including a 3 year relationship with the Women in Cloud community. During this immersive 3-month program the Cloud Accelerator provides: access to industry leaders, structured training, office hours, industry events, self-learning content, and more, all via digital platforms making the Accelerator accessible to women-led businesses worldwide. Women in Cloud is excited to announce the following companies as accepted in the 7.0 cohort of their award-winning Cloud Cosell Accelerator:

  • AffableBPM- SaaS based Fully Customizable Business Workflow Management to provide Automated Compliance checks, Paperless – end to end, Cut down manpower up to 65% and Cost savings up to 50% . It is quick and easy to install and adopt!

  • Liiingo– Liiingo’s platform enables businesses to effectively connect, engage, and their shared customers’ journey, so they can nurture and benefit from repeat business and referrals. Liiingo’s mobile engagement platform removes those barriers for customers with our patented language delivery solution, as well as providing an intuitive an engaging experience.

  • LockDocs: LockDocs is a Digital-identity-as-a-service platform for the financial services sector. We are transforming how financial institutions collect and manage and customer data by offering a frictionless customer experience and generating significant time and cost savings in the process.

  • MyExcelia: MyExcelia is an AI-powered voice-enabled pocket coach that records voice, translates to text, anonymizes input, and provides in-the moment communication improvement feedback to managers, coaches, leaders, and employees at all levels without further input or effort from the employee.

  • OfficeTroops: Offers a global technology supported service to help small and medium organizations source, manage and nurture their future talent. The fight for talent requires a concerted effort at career brand development, candidate engagement and technology in hiring. Large organizations have substantial budgets to do this. We bring that same caliber to small and mid size businesses (SMB) who might otherwise lose out in this fight. Our solution centers around a white labelled hiring platform combined with concierge level placement services. We augment SMB hiring teams from day one and give them hiring scale at an attractive price point.

  • Accelera : The Maestro Ecosystem is a complete, all-in-one digital transformation tool. We partner with various technologies in payments, finance, and customer service through the API management layer. We use a digital identifier in a multi-tenanted environment to segregate a client’s data, which is orchestrated, headlessly, and displayed on a webpage.

  • Sapta Inc: Sapta is a cloud-based enterprise value management software built to help organizations achieve sustainable accelerated growth eliminating management chaos. The integrated management platform helps enterprises build OKRs, fuel innovation, make faster business decisions, and create a seamless CX journey.

  • Viverie AI: Viverie AI is the vision and brain for various types of smart robots, cameras, and sensors. Through collaborative training, our AI can be your solution for your specific needs. 

  • iLEAP Group: A Cloud MSP Provider transforming HBCU ecosystem with Cloud Services with IP based solutions.

About the Partner Capital Fund loan program:

  • Partner can apply for loans ranging from $25,000 to $500,000.
  • Loans maintain terms of less than 60 months.
  • No or low interest will be charged for payment terms (Microsoft will cover all or most of the interest costs).
  • Eligibility is based upon financial and other information provided.

Partner Capital Fund eligibility requirements:

  • Partner must be based in the U.S.
  • Partner must be enrolled and active in the Microsoft Partner Network.
  • Eligible businesses who are partners include those who are:
    • Offering consulting services that utilize Microsoft products OR
    • Building on a Microsoft platform to build their own business OR
    • Developing app using Microsoft products OR
    • Creating IP using Microsoft products (i.e., organizations who are willing to build unique technology on the Microsoft platform).
  • Partner must be in good standing (i.e., no disputed accounts receivable greater than or equal to 60 days).
  • Partner must have less than $7M in annualized revenue.
  • Partner must have ability to provide three years of financial statements (reviewed or audited) or provide three years of federal tax returns.
  • Startup organizations must provide a five-year projection or business plan.
  • Additional items may be requested from Microsoft’s banking partner.
  • Partner must self-certify responses.
  • Commitment to allocate forecasted spend on Microsoft products or services reviewed as a percentage of the loan. Details to be provided during review process.

Last February 25, we hosted a new and exciting Lunch and Learn session with one of the Fortune 100 companies: JPMorgan Chase. The #WICxFortune100 Lunch and Learn series is a space where women in tech can connect, learn, and network with fortune companies and brands. Its goal is to generate access to new jobs opportunities focused on digital transformation, teach how to navigate and do business with the company, create new connections, and get a deeper insight into innovative enterprise-ready cloud solutions.

JPMorgan Chase is committed to its talent, diversity, and equity.

JPMorgan Chase is deeply committed to diversity and inclusion. Ebele Kemery, Head of Global Technology Diversity, Equity & Inclusion, started the session with a Power Talk about the power of strategic partnering with JPMorgan Chase and how it shapes the interaction and growth of the company globally. She also emphasized the importance of DEI for the company and how “the diversity of our perspectives and backgrounds are critical to developing new ideas.”

Nowadays, JPMorgan Chase is deeply focused on developing new Data and Cybersecurity technologies to keep improving the relationship with their customers and expand to new markets. Nonetheless, for the Head of Architecture, Cloud, and Engineering, Stephen Flaherty, talent stays at the forefront of the company alongside its diversity and inclusion culture.

Power Panel: Trifecta Approach to Building Strategic Relationship with JPMorgan Chase

We also held the largest panel in the history of WIC’s Lunch and Learn series so far. The panel took place with the participation of Monika Panpaliya (Head of Global Technology Product & Agility Office)as moderator, Kanti Shrestha (Head of Enterprise Technology Communications), Lauren Goodwin (Chief Technology Officer), Thulasi Kethini (Head of Software Engineering, Data Platform, Executive Director), Sarita Bakst ( Head of Information Architecture for Firm Wide Data Management), Arup Nanda (Global Head of Architecture – Enterprise Data), Zubair Quazi (Managing Director, Core Development), and Manasa Hari (Head of Data Platform Foundational Services, Executive Director) as panelists.

They discussed their great culture of respect in JPMorgan Chase and shared in-depth how the company is looking at the improvements in the technology landscape. They also showcased how to navigate the company and all the business transformation aspects, its culture of diversity and inclusion, and its importance for JPMorgan Chase. 

Attendees got a good sense of what it’s like to work at JPMorgan Chase in the hands of its leaders and employees. On the other hand, attendees were also able to look at the hiring opportunities at JPMorgan Chase, which currently has over 4.000 jobs available in the cloud and data management field. Still, also it served as great insight for aspirants to get to know what the company is looking for as their ideal candidate for these positions.

Cloud Solution Showcase: amazing innovation by women-led companies.

We were so excited to present two women-led companies that created solutions that can be implemented in organizations such as JPMorgan Chase. 

First, we presented Geetha Ramaswamy, CEO of Traice. She created an AI-enabled early warning risk detection and monitoring of businesses like JP Morgan Chase to make key decisions such as underwriting, investing, an extension of the line of credit, among others. Her solution allows companies to detect financial risks even six months in advance.

Second, we presented Bhavya Agarwal, CEO of ZipBoard. She’s also an entrepreneur and cloud founder who created ZipBoard, a digital content review platform helping improve the content feedback process on websites, courses, videos, and documents by making it visual and easy.
